How much do base builder j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for base builder in Springfield, MA is $22.74,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.66 and $25.38 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by base builders, and how can they be overcome?

Base Builders often encounter challenges related to coordinating the logistics of site setup, managing multiple contractors, and ensuring safety compliance. Balancing project deadlines while adapting to unexpected issues, such as weather delays or supply chain disruptions, is also common. To overcome these challenges, successful Base Builders rely on strong organizational skills, clear communication with team members and stakeholders, and proactive risk management. Regular team meetings and thorough pre-construction planning help ensure that everyone is aligned and potential problems are addressed early.
